October 26, 2021

Notorious British Killers - Episode 293


Image: Wikimedia (CC BY 4.0)

Britain has had its fair share, or more than its fair share of gruesome killers. Perhaps the most famous serial killer of them all did his deeds in the heart of London's east end; Jack The Ripper! But in the centuries since, Britain has sadly had more than a few notorious killers and in this episode, we talk about some of the most notorious of all!

Have you heard of any of these notorious British killers?

